contrast<br>For the detection of tyrosinase, a variety of methods have been developed. It is mainly based on fluorescence, colorimetry and electrochemistry. The detection limits and characteristics of the methods proposed in the literature and electrochemical methods in this paper are shown in Table 3. It can be seen from table 3 that compared with the traditional fluorescence method and colorimetric method, this experimental method has certain advantages in terms of accuracy, cost-effectiveness and stability, and [(PSS / PPy) (p2mo18 / PPy) 5] composite multilayer film modified electrode has lower detection limit for tyrosinase detection, which can be used as a rapid screening method or for on-line detection of tyrosinase content to realize the detection of tyrosinase Study on the quality of aquatic products or monitor the freshness of aquatic products.<br>
